mirth

音標(biāo)[m?:θ]
mirth是什么意思、mirth怎么讀

mirth漢語翻譯

n. 歡笑, 歡樂, 愉快

mirth英語解釋

名詞 mirth:

  1. great merriment
    同義詞:hilarity, mirthfulness, glee, gleefulness

mirth例句

  1. The announcement was greeted with much hilarity and mirth.
    這一項(xiàng)宣布引起了熱烈的歡呼聲。
  2. When I told them what had happened to me, they all chortled with mirth.
    我把我的事告訴他們以後,他們咯咯地笑起來了。
  3. Christmas is a time of mirth, especially for children.
    圣誕節(jié)是個(gè)快樂的日子,尤其是對(duì)孩子們。

mirth詳細(xì)解釋

mirth

n.(名詞)
Gladness and gaiety, especially when expressed by laughter.
歡樂:歡樂和愉快,尤指用笑來表達(dá)

來源:
Middle English
中古英語
from Old English myrgth * see mregh-u-
源自 古英語 myrgth *參見 mregh-u-

<參考詞匯><同義詞>mirth,merriment,jollity,hilarity,gleeThese nouns denote a state of joyful exuberance.
這些名詞都指示洋溢著歡樂的狀態(tài)。
Mirth stresses lightheartedness and gaiety;it often suggests easy laughter:
Mirth 強(qiáng)調(diào)的是心情輕松和歡愉,它通常暗示著輕松的笑聲:
例句:
.Again the young friends gave way to their mirth. (Henry Wadsworth Longfellow).
.年輕的朋友們又一次歡笑起來. (亨利·華茲渥斯·朗費(fèi)羅)。

Merriment is high-spirited fun and enjoyment:
Merriment 是一種情緒很高的快樂和歡愉:
例句:
Her escapades were a subject of merriment in the sorority house.
在女生聯(lián)誼會(huì)中,她的惡作劇總是歡樂的根源。

Jollity applies to convivial merriment or celebration:
Jollity 指的是歡宴作樂的歡樂或慶典:
例句:
.Perhaps [an English pub is] a place of rural jollity with log fires crackling and grinning farm lads slurping pints and squaring up to the dart board. (John Mortimer).
.也許 是鄉(xiāng)間歡樂的地方——木柴燃燒在發(fā)出爆裂聲,咧嘴笑著的、咕嘟咕嘟地喝著一品脫一品脫酒的農(nóng)場工們正圍在飛標(biāo)靶旁邊. (約翰·莫蒂默)。

Hilarity is great, often uproarious merriment:
Hilarity 指的是強(qiáng)烈的,經(jīng)常是爆發(fā)性的歡樂:
例句:
.Fan the sinking flame of hilarity with the wing of friendship;and pass the rosy wine. (Charles Dickens).
.用友誼將正在熄滅的歡樂火焰重新扇起;并傳遞著玫瑰色的美酒. (查理斯·狄更斯)。

Glee applies especially to jubilant delight resulting from a particular circumstance,such as winning a victory (
Glee 特指由某一特定情景導(dǎo)致的歡騰中的快樂,如贏得勝利(
例句:
Her glee knew no bounds when she crossed the finish line first); it may suggest spiteful pleasuresuch as that experienced at another`s bad fortune (
當(dāng)她第一個(gè)沖過終線時(shí)她簡直高興極了); 這一詞也暗含一種不高尚的歡樂,如當(dāng)別人倒霉時(shí)幸災(zāi)樂禍的愉快(

例句:
He laughed with glee when he learned of his opponent`s defeat).
當(dāng)?shù)弥獙?duì)手失敗時(shí),他不免有些幸災(zāi)樂禍)
